So I saw some rumblings about this yesterday, this narrative that the Cubs played scared or weak baseball by walking Bryce Harper all series long. To be honest I didn’t think it was real, I thought it was a few salty fans complaining about a loss. But now I see it’s coming from actual players on the Nats and I can’t help but laugh. Hello? You play to win the game. You know how you stop teams from walking Bryce? Put a good player behind him in the lineup. Why the fuck would Joe Maddon pitch to Bryce Harper when he can instead let Ryan Zimmerman go 2 for 19 (he stranded FOURTEEN runners on Sunday). That’s the person people should be mad at. Not the Cubs, not Maddon, not Harper, you should be mad at Dusty Baker for being a moron and Ryan Zimmerman for sucking ass. Did the Nats intentionally walk Bryant? No because Anthony Rizzo is behind him. Or how about Rizzo? No because Ben Zobrist is behind him. And on and on we go. You can’t be mad if your roster is unbalanced and you aren’t properly protecting the best player in baseball. And make no mistake Nats fans, this is just the start. Like Barry Bonds back in the day, once people realize they can pitch around a player because he has no lineup protection it will start happening all the time. The Cubs may have been the first team to do this but they certainly won’t be the last.
